In a world increasingly shaped by intelligent devices that connect, sense, and perceive our surroundings, Ceva has announced it has surpassed 20 billion Ceva-powered devices shipped globally. As a foundational technology provider of the mobile and IoT eras, this milestone sets the stage for the next phase — bringing the power of on-device AI to every corner of the smart-edge ecosystem, across consumer, automotive, industrial, mobile, PC and IoT markets. 

“Surpassing 20 billion devices is more than a milestone— it’s a testament to Ceva’s role as a trusted innovation partner to the world’s leading technology companies,” said Amir Panush, CEO of Ceva. “We couldn’t have achieved this without our employees, customers, and partners – the driving force behind our success. “For more than two decades, our IP has quietly powered the intelligent edge — connecting, sensing, and processing data in products that shape everyday life. Today, we’re entering a new era of opportunity, where scalable on-device AI and edge intelligence are redefining how systems interact with the world around them. Ceva is uniquely positioned to lead this transformation, delivering the IP foundation our customers need to build the next generation of smart, adaptive, and differentiated products.”

“Ceva has been a trusted partner to Actions Technology for many years,” said Dr. Zhengyu Zhou, Chairman and CEO of Actions Technology. “Their Bluetooth and audio IPs have been instrumental in enabling us to deliver hundreds of millions of high-quality AIoT SoCs to our customers.”

“Ceva’s 20 billion device milestone highlights their impact on smart, low-power innovation at the edge. At Ambiq, we share a common mission to enable intelligent, energy-efficient devices that are shaping the future of connected technology,” said Scott Hanson, CTO of Ambiq.

“Ceva has been a key enabler for ASR since day one, helping us expand into multiple markets with a broad portfolio powered by their connectivity and sensing IPs,” said Dr. Xikai Zhao, Vice President of ASR Microelectronics.

“Ceva’s wireless connectivity IP has been essential in helping us deliver high-performance, low-power connectivity across a wide range of consumer and IoT applications for more than a decade,” said Dr. Pengfei Zhang, CEO of Beken Corporation. “Their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, and DSP IPs enable us to consistently meet the requirements of smart, connected devices with exceptional performance and efficiency.”

“Our collaboration with Ceva has enabled us to lead the ultra-low power wireless smart audio market with cutting-edge solutions,” said Mr. Guoguang Zhao, CEO and Vice Chairman of Bestechnic. “Together, we’ve shipped more than a billion earbuds, smartwatches, wireless speakers and smartglasses that deliver ultra-low power and seamless wireless performance.”

“Ceva’s sensor fusion software has played a vital role in enhancing the Magic Motion Remote experience across LG TVs powered by webOS, where intuitive navigation feels effortless and natural,” said Neo Lee, Senior Director of webOS Product Planning at LG Electronics. “

“Ceva’s DSPs deliver the performance and flexibility we need to enable our 5G and beyond networks,” said Derek Urbaniak, Head of SoC, Nokia Mobile Networks. “Their solutions have helped us scale efficiently while maintaining the industry-leading performance our customers expect from our Base Station and Radio products.”

“Our long-standing collaboration with Ceva has helped us deliver robust, high-impact solutions to our connected MCU customers,” said Charles Dachs, Senior Vice President & General Manager at NXP Semiconductors.

“Our partnership with Ceva has helped us enable advanced connectivity, imaging, audio, and AI capabilities faster,” said Hisato Yoshida, COO of Socionext. “Their comprehensive IP portfolio and technical expertise have been key in enabling high-performance SoCs across multiple product categories.”

“Ceva has been a trusted partner in our journey to deliver high-performance, energy-efficient chip experiences,” said UNISOC. “Their IP has helped us bring advanced connectivity and multimedia capabilities to billions of users worldwide.”
